How they compare
Armenia currently reports 0.6794 using mean against 0.668 using mean in Argentina, a difference of 0.0114 using mean.
The two have swapped places 7 times across 10 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Argentina ahead.
Argentina ranks 51st and Armenia ranks 49th of 60 countries.
Armenia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
